Hundreds of barred owls to be killed to prevent extinction of spotted owls

Barred owls are larger, more aggressive and eat a wider variety of food. The U.S. Fish and Wildlife Service plan to kill hundreds of thousands of barred owls in an effort to keep spotted owls from extinction.
